From Somewhere: Spring/Summer 2012

How perfect are these summer dresses ‘From Somewhere’?!

The principle behind this label seeks to answer a simple question: What happens to the fashion industry’s waste? – The answer is the bin, then landfills and then the incineraters. It is extremely wasteful and destructive, afterall ours is a precious earth. Luckily, From Somewhere creates sustinable fashion from these luxury designer cut offs, unwanted, discarded but still perfectly good.

Beautiful, poetic, and ethical.

Style Icon: Marianne Faithful

Singer/songwriter, actress and muse. Marianne Faithful was the original wild girl of rock. She has been a style icon and respected musican for decades (her fashion sense most famously mimiced by the likes of Kate Moss). Today you would probably class Faithful’s style as ‘rock chic’, I adore it for her originality and effortlessness.

The young star was Mick Jagger’s girlfriend for five years in the late sixties, and according to rock legend inspired some classic Stones songs (‘you can’t always get what you want’ and ‘lets spend the night together’ to name a few).

Faithful was always a legendary party animal, she was once found wearing nothing but a rug during a famous police search of Keith Richard’s house in 1967. But sadly, the singer fell victim to an increasing dependency on herione. By the early seventies Faithful was homeless. She spent two years living on the streets of London. It’s the sort of tragic story that often comes with fame and rock n’ roll.

Luckily for us, Marianne was able to recover, few stars from the sixties have reinvented themselves as successfully as her.
